Algebra Seminar: Bazhanov -- Quantum Dilogarithms and New Integrable Lattice Models in Three Dimension

Vladimir Bazhanov (ANU) will be speaking in the algebra seminar.  We will go out for
lunch after the talk---all are welcome to join! 

When: 12-1pm Friday April 17 

Where: Carslaw 175 

Title: Quantum Dilogarithms and New Integrable Lattice Models in Three Dimension 

Abstract: In this talk I will introduce a new class of integrable 3D lattice models,
possessing continuous families of commuting layer-to-layer transfer matrices.
Algebraically, this commutativity is based on a very special construction of local
Boltzmann weights in terms of quantum dilogarithms satisfying the inversion and pentagon
identities.  The partition function per site in these models can be exactly calculated
in the limit of an infinite lattice by using the functional relations, symmetry and
factorization properties of the transfer matrix.  Remarkably, the integrability
conditions in some of these 3D models could also be related with quantization of
geometric incidence theorems for three-dimensional circular quadrilateral lattices
(lattices whose faces are planar quadrilaterals inscribable into a circle).  This talk
is based on joint works with Rinat Kashaev, Vladimir Mangazeev and Sergey Sergeev.
